What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ues for drivers in the Baroda, Michigan area?

Given our local climate and road conditions, common issues include brake corrosion from winter road salt, suspension wear from uneven rural roads, and cooling system problems exacerbated by temperature swings. For specific models like the Chevrolet Equinox or Silverado, local shops often see transmission and electrical concerns.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Chevrolet repair shop in or near Baroda?

Look for a shop with GM or Chevrolet-specific certifications (like ASE technicians with GM training) and strong local reviews. In the Baroda/Bridgman area, it's also beneficial to choose a shop experienced with vehicles common to our region, such as trucks and SUVs used for farming or seasonal lake traffic.

When should I seek local service instead of driving to a dealership in a larger city like St. Joseph or Benton Harbor?

Seek local Baroda service for most routine maintenance, diagnostics, and common repairs for faster turnaround and often more personalized service. For highly complex computer issues, major warranty work, or specific recall repairs that require proprietary dealership tools, the larger city dealerships may be necessary.

Are repair costs for Chevrolets generally higher in the Baroda area compared to bigger cities?

Labor rates at independent shops in Baroda can be slightly lower than at dealerships in metropolitan areas, potentially saving you money. However, parts costs are largely consistent, and the overall price depends more on the shop's expertise and the specific repair needed for your vehicle.

What local factors in Baroda should I consider when maintaining my Chevrolet?

Prioritize undercarriage washes in winter to combat salt corrosion on brakes and frames. Also, consider more frequent air filter changes due to dust from rural and agricultural roads. Preparing your cooling system for summer heat and winter freeze is crucial given Michigan's temperature extremes.
